为什么excel文字变成数字
作者:路由通
|
155人看过
发布时间:2026-01-23 20:59:25
标签:
在使用电子表格软件处理数据时,许多用户都曾遭遇过输入的文字信息被自动转换为数字格式的困扰。这种现象背后隐藏着软件智能识别机制、单元格格式预设、外部数据导入规范等多重因素。本文将系统剖析十二个关键成因,从基础操作到深层原理,涵盖格式设置、函数影响、系统兼容性等维度,并提供切实可行的解决方案,帮助用户彻底掌握文本与数字格式的转换逻辑。
当我们精心输入的客户编号「001」突然变成赤裸裸的「1」,当身份证号码末尾四位神秘变为「0」,这种电子表格软件中的文本变数字现象,堪称数据工作者日常办公中的典型困扰。作为一名长期观察办公软件生态的编辑,我深知这种看似简单的格式转换背后,实则牵连着软件设计逻辑、数据存储原理与用户操作习惯的复杂博弈。本文将通过多维视角,深入解析这一现象的产生机制与应对策略。
单元格格式的预设机制 电子表格软件默认将所有单元格视为数字容器,这种设计源于其最初面向财务计算场景的基因。当用户输入纯数字组合时,软件的内置解析引擎会主动将其识别为数值型数据。例如输入「1-2」这类带分隔符的内容时,程序可能误判为日期格式而返回「1月2日」。这种自动类型转换功能虽在计算场景中提升效率,却对需要保留前导零的编码类文本造成毁灭性打击。 科学计数法的强制转换 当输入超过11位的数字串时,软件会自动启用科学计数法显示规则。这对18位身份证号码、16位银行卡号等长数字文本构成严重威胁。更隐蔽的风险在于,即使单元格宽度足以显示完整数字,只要格式未预设为文本,输入时仍可能被截断处理。微软官方文档明确建议,处理超过15位的数字时应提前设置文本格式,因为双精度浮点数存储机制会导致15位后的精度丢失。 外部数据导入的格式识别 从数据库导出的CSV(逗号分隔值)文件在打开时,软件的数据导入向导会主动进行类型检测。若未在向导第二步手动指定列格式,系统将根据首行数据特征自动判定类型。比如以「0123」开头的客户编号列,可能因首行为「1001」而被整体设为数值格式。国家统计局数据处理规范特别强调,导入含编码类数据时应使用「数据→分列」功能强制指定文本格式。 公式函数的隐性类型转换 使用VLOOKUP(垂直查找)等函数进行数据匹配时,若查找值与源数据格式不一致,函数会先尝试类型统一。例如用数字格式的「1001」查找文本格式的「1001」,系统可能先将文本转为数字再比对,导致匹配失败。专业解决方案是使用TEXT(文本)函数统一格式,如「=VLOOKUP(TEXT(A1,"0"),B:C,2,0)」确保类型同步。 粘贴操作中的格式继承 从网页或文档复制数据时,若使用常规粘贴,目标单元格将继承源格式属性。曾有用户从PDF复制产品编码「002.3」后变成「2.3」,正是因粘贴时携带了数值格式。建议采用「选择性粘贴→值」切断格式传递,或粘贴后立即使用「开始→清除→格式」重置单元格属性。 自定义格式的视觉欺骗 部分用户通过设置自定义格式「000」使数字「1」显示为「001」,但这仅是视觉修饰,实际存储值仍是数值1。用此类数据做关键词匹配时会出现本质错误。真正解决方案应先在空白列使用=TEXT(A1,"000")生成真实文本,再复制为值使用。 系统区域设置的潜在影响 操作系统区域设置中的数字分隔符规则,可能导致「1,234」被解析为1234。当文件在不同区域设置的设备间传递时,这种隐式转换会造成数据解读差异。国际标准化组织建议,跨地区协作文件应在首页注明数字格式标准,或使用单引号前置符「'」强制文本化。 特殊符号触发的类型转换 输入含百分号、货币符号的内容时,软件会自动激活相应格式。比如「5%」即刻转为0.05,「¥100」转为数值100。如需保留原貌,应在输入前先键入单引号,或使用「=CHAR(36)&"100"」这类公式构造真实文本。 条件格式规则的误判 当条件格式设置「当值为数字时改变颜色」等规则,可能反向诱发软件重新解释单元格内容。某些情况下,为满足条件格式逻辑,系统会尝试将文本内容数值化。建议检查条件格式适用范围,对文本区域设置「当文本包含时」类规则。 数据验证规则的冲突 若单元格被设置「整数」验证规则,输入文本型数字时系统会强制转换以通过验证。这种设计虽保障了数据规范性,但破坏了需要文本格式的场景。应在数据验证设置时选择「自定义」,用「=ISTEXT(A1)」公式专门保护文本字段。 宏代码的强制类型转换 使用VBA(可视化基础应用程序)宏处理数据时,类似「Cells(1,1).Value = "0123"」的赋值语句可能因变量类型声明不当而丢失前导零。应在代码中显式声明单元格格式属性,如「Cells(1,1).NumberFormat = ""」确保文本格式。 版本兼容性引发的格式重置 低版本软件打开高版本创建的文件时,可能因功能不支持而重置单元格格式。比如用电子表格软件2007打开包含新文本函数的文件时,相关单元格可能退回常规格式。微软兼容性中心建议,跨版本传递文件时应另存为97-2003格式,并提前将关键文本列备份为值。 自动更正功能的过度干预 软件内置的自动更正列表可能将特定数字组合替换为日期,如「3/4」转为「3月4日」。需在「文件→选项→校对→自动更正选项」中取消「替换输入内容时」相关勾选,并对已转换内容使用撤销快捷键恢复。 共享工作簿的格式同步冲突 多用户协同编辑时,若两人同时修改同一单元格的格式属性,后保存者将覆盖前者设置。企业部署应建立格式规范手册,对编码类字段实施单元格保护,或使用专业协作平台确保格式版本可控。 打印机驱动引发的格式异常 极少数情况下,特定打印机驱动会要求文档进行格式标准化,导致打印预览时文本意外转为数字。可尝试切换为微软打印PDF虚拟打印机测试,若问题消失则需更新原驱动。 内存优化机制的数据截断 处理百万行级数据时,软件为提升性能可能启用内存压缩技术,这可能导致长数字文本的后几位被舍入为零。应对超大数据集时应分拆处理,或改用专业数据库工具保障完整性。 通过这十六个维度的剖析,我们可见电子表格中文本数字转换问题实为系统复杂性体现。解决问题的核心在于建立预防意识:在处理任何含数字的文本前,优先设置文本格式;导入外部数据时手动控制类型判断;关键数据保存后实施格式验证。唯有理解软件行为逻辑,才能让技术真正服务于数据管理需求。
相关文章
本文深入探讨杰理蓝牙芯片的编程方法,涵盖从开发环境搭建、软件开发工具包(SDK)使用到具体功能实现的完整流程。文章详细解析了芯片初始化、蓝牙协议栈配置、外设驱动编写以及功耗优化等核心环节,旨在为开发者提供一套系统化、实用性强的技术指南,帮助读者快速掌握杰理蓝牙应用的开发技巧。
2026-01-23 20:59:23
223人看过
当我们使用文字处理软件时,可能会注意到文档窗口的右下角有一个可拖动的小三角标记。这个设计并非随意为之,而是承载着多项实用功能的重要界面元素。它既是页面布局的直观指示器,又是快速调整视图比例的操作手柄,更是软件人性化设计的体现。本文将深入解析这个小三角的起源、功能演变及其在日常办公中的实际应用价值,帮助用户更充分地利用这一常被忽视的高效工具。
2026-01-23 20:58:33
204人看过
二极管作为一种基础的半导体元器件,其核心功能是实现电流的单向导通。本文将深入剖析二极管在整流、稳压、信号检测、电路保护等十二个关键领域的具体作用,并结合实际应用场景,解释其工作原理。无论是电源设计还是射频电路,二极管都扮演着不可或缺的角色,理解其功能是掌握电子技术的重要基石。
2026-01-23 20:58:14
379人看过
四旋翼飞行器的充电操作直接影响设备寿命与飞行安全。本文将系统解析智能电池工作原理,对比标准充电与快速充电模式差异,详解充电器指示灯识别技巧。从环境选择、接口清洁到充电周期规划,提供十二项专业操作指南。针对极端温度防护、电池存储保养等场景,结合航空电源管理技术规范,帮助用户建立科学充电体系,最大限度延长电池使用寿命。
2026-01-23 20:57:51
368人看过
为汽车更换发动机是一项复杂且成本差异巨大的工程。本文将从全新原厂发动机、再制造发动机、二手拆车件等不同来源,系统分析其价格区间。文章深度剖析影响总成本的核心因素,包括发动机本身费用、工时费、辅料费以及潜在的电脑程序匹配与法律手续成本。同时,将对比更换发动机与维修、置换整车的利弊,并提供关键决策建议与避坑指南,旨在为面临此困境的车主提供一份全面、客观、实用的参考。
2026-01-23 20:57:08
268人看过
电子纸显示屏(EPD)是一种基于电泳技术的反射式显示装置,其通过带电粒子在电场作用下的移动实现图像刷新。该技术具有超低功耗、类纸张视觉体验以及强光下可读性强等特性,主要应用于电子书阅读器、零售价签、智能办公等领域,是数字信息显示方案中的重要分支。
2026-01-23 20:56:51
375人看过
热门推荐
资讯中心:
.webp)


.webp)
.webp)
